**Q: Why did Squatternet flag a package our customer actually wanted?**

Squatternet scores packages by name similarity to popular registries, so legit forks with close names (like `fastparse2`) sometimes trip the threshold. Tell the customer it's a warning, not a block — they can allowlist the package in their Squatternet dashboard under Policy Exceptions. If the same false positive keeps coming up across accounts, we'll tune the model. Send recurring cases to the scanner team for review.

alerts address for fajeg-baduf: druael@torvahq.corp

## Runbook: Gaugepile Sidecar — Release Checklist

Heads up: the sidecar ships with every app pod, so a bad config fans out fast. Before cutting a release, confirm the flush interval hasn't drifted from what the Tallyhouse aggregator expects, or you'll see sawtooth gaps in dashboards. Rollbacks are cheap — just repin the image tag. Canary one node pool first, watch for ten minutes, then proceed. The values to verify against are these.

config for bagep-yafof:
quenath:
  pin: 8584
  metrics_host: metrics.quenath.tolvaqsys.internal
  tenant: pelath
  seal: seal_ed102645

HANDOVER NOTE — from Director Pell to Director Rask

For the sales leads: the Kestrine liability policy renews next month. Broker quotes are in; premiums up roughly nine percent. I've flagged the coverage gap on the Tarnow warehouse. Rask will finalize terms and brief you all. Please read the confidential context that follows.

confidential, yawif-fadup: The southern region missed its Eliius quota by 61.1 percent last quarter. Istixax Freight plans to raise the Jorwyn list price by 65.7 percent in October. The board signed off on a budget of $445.3 million for Project Ulaox. The renewal with Briathax Partners closes at $41.0 million a year, 49.9 percent below the last contract.

Handover note — Priya to Tomas

While I'm away, lost-badge requests come to the assistants' desk first. Log the name, floor, and time reported, then issue a paper day pass from the grey folder. Replacement badges are printed by Facilities at Merrow House on Tuesdays and Thursdays only, so remind people there may be a wait. If someone needs door access before their replacement arrives, they can use the shared assistants' code at the east stairwell keypad. Here it is for reference.

staff pass of kagup-fajog = bdg-QCHVQW-99665837